

LICENSURE At the time of making this Contract, Manager and Boxer shall be licensed by the Commission with which this contract is filed, or, if not so licensed, submit an application for such licensure within (10) days of the making of this contract.īoxer and Manager agree that if either is duly notified that their license has been revoked, suspended or denied by the Commission, the contract may be declared null and void. Manager agrees to make no contract for a boxing contest where Manager has a direct or indirect contractual interest in Boxer’s opponent unless Manager fully discloses such interest to Boxer and Boxer approves. Manager agrees to use Manager’s best efforts to secure remunerative boxing contest and at all times to act in the best interests of Boxer. Manager agrees to make no contract for a boxing contest without the express agreement and approval of Boxer.

If during the term of this agreement the boxer is mentally, physically or legally incapacitated to such an extent that Boxer is rendered unable to participate in professional boxing contests, the obligations of the Boxer and Manager relating to the minimum bouts and terms of this agreement shall automatically be extended by the period of such incapacitation(s). In the event there is any suspension to or injury or illness of the Boxer or his opponent, the obligation of Boxer and Manager relating to the minimum bouts, timing of the bouts, and the terms of this agreement shall automatically be extended by the period of time necessary to reschedule the postponed bout. At no time shall the AGREES: boxer make less than $_ per year for participating in boxing contests and exhibitions. MANAGER Manager agrees to secure for Boxer a minimum of _ bouts per calendar year. Boxer agrees not to take part or engage in any boxing contests or exhibitions unless Boxer has obtained the written permission of Manager to do so. Provisions for the payment of any training expenses, travel expenses, bonuses, stipends, loans, or any other monetary agreement between Manager and Boxer shall be set forth in an addendum to this contract and if the provision for such payment is not listed as part of such addendum, it shall not be enforceable.ĪCCOUNTING In regard to each boxing contest in which Boxer is contractually obligated to participate, Manager shall provide Boxer with a detailed accounting of any deductions made from the purse monies earned by Boxer including deductions for training expenses, travel expenses, bonuses, stipends, loans, or any other advances.īOXER AGREES: Once Boxer agrees to participate in a boxing contest or exhibition, Boxer shall take all steps reasonably necessary to prepare himself or herself for the contest or exhibition.

This contract may not be extended beyond its initial term unless, a new contract, mutually agreeable to the parties, is executed.ĬOMPENSATION Boxer shall pay directly to Manager, or as a deduction from the amount remitted by the promoter, (_%) of all purse monies paid to Boxer as a result of Boxer participating in a boxing contest.
